    My 2022 gt500 3.8 whipple

    950whp on the 3.7 pulley on 93 is totally reasonable on a somewhat cooler day 17lbs of boost at 8000rpm assuming 2" headers & no cats for better flow.. probably not in 100 degree weather obviously My 3.8 whipple on one pulley bigger (less boost) 3.85 made 915rwhp on 93oct... 75 degrees...

    3.8 Whipple on 93 octane

    I have Exactly the setup you're inquiring about with dyno sheets. 21 GT500 3.8 whipple just as the kit comes on 93 & E85 2in American racing headers to a borla Atack exhaust ID1300 injectors On the 3.865 pulley the kit comes with Made 915rwhp on 93 And 1030 on E85 HPP Racing did the full...
